Output 432c597c6c287858c7b4adba91b69f77b19bf8c128ee54270cc78cf4ba831194:0

value
172437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7253f77f2e75f91790355be51ae825d4dfc50fb OP_EQUAL
address
3MJbppRSUqbiZsZ4QufvntZMohKr3EyEjh
transaction
432c597c6c287858c7b4adba91b69f77b19bf8c128ee54270cc78cf4ba831194
spent
true